Can men wear a nice black or dark suit and tie for formal night in lieu of a tux?

Do most men wear a suit for semi-formal night?

What do you suggest for little boys for both nights (2 & 5 years old)?

What do women wear? We are not talking ball length gowns just a very nice dress and say nice pant suit?
 
Plenty of men wear suits on formal night instead of a tux, it's perfectly fine. :) Some men wear suits on semi-formal nights, others just wear sportcoats and pants, with or without ties.

The boys can wear anything they are comfortable in. :) A nice pair of khakis and a polo shirt or button-down shirt are fine. You can dress them up more if you want but it's not necessary.

Women wear everything from dressy pantsuits to ball gowns on formal nights. Whatever you choose within that range is entirely appropriate. :)
 
I can definitely second what Michelle said--I saw everything from Tuxedos to Polo style shirts on formal night. Most were wearing either Tuxedos or Suits though.

On semi-formal night there were still a few tuxedos, mostly suits and sport coats, and a few of the polos again.

As for women--there are a lot of long gowns, short gowns, dressy dresses, and pantsuits for both nights.

I think it depends on the individual family as to how dressed or not they are. Kids are perfectly acceptable in whatever they or you are comfortable with them wearing. I noticed most being in tune with what the rest of the family was wearing.

Be assured that whatever you choose you won't be out of place. There are all kinds on the cruise.
